JAVA
文章平均质量分 80
kangxingang
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
List 的 removeAll 方法的效率
Java中,List是最常用到的一种集合类。我们也经常对List进行操作,也没有碰到什么问题。但是刚刚在调用removeAll方法是,碰到了严重的性能问题。 问题是这样的: 原集合:List source,有大概200,000数据。 目标集合:List destination,有大概150,000数据。 两者中都可能有重复的元素,两者中可能有相同的元素。已经实现了T中的hashCode()原创 2013-06-08 23:32:34 · 8917 阅读 · 7 评论 -
插入排序 Insertion Sort
插入排序:流程描述 从第一个元素开始,该元素可以认为已经被排序。选中下一个元素,从已经排好序的元素中从后向前扫描。如果该元素(已排序的)大于选中元素,则将该元素移动到它后面的位置。重复3步骤,直到找到已排序的元素小于等于选中元素。将选中元素插入4步骤元素的后面。重复2-5步骤。 插入排序:简单例子 3 7 9 6 8 0 2 5 13 7 9 6 8 0 2 5 13 7 9原创 2013-06-17 23:05:16 · 529 阅读 · 0 评论
分享